Output dffb63bdc6f60d26e10d4828328679c881fab5a1eb146711fc29cf6d7bdb16f2:51

value
121108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c73f13d92d0890fbb65da703d51788ec4079bb0 OP_EQUAL
address
3JsTrRWBpQMyXdJ43qffPZj9aCrmqaqqMb
transaction
dffb63bdc6f60d26e10d4828328679c881fab5a1eb146711fc29cf6d7bdb16f2
spent
true